'''Grid'5000 is a large-scale and flexible testbed for experiment-driven research in all areas of computer science, with a focus on parallel and distributed computing including Cloud, HPC and Big Data and AI.'''  | |||
Key features:  | |||
* provides '''access to a large amount of resources''': 15000 cores, 800 compute-nodes grouped in homogeneous clusters, and featuring various technologies: PMEM, GPU, SSD, NVMe, 10G and 25G Ethernet, Infiniband, Omni-Path  | |||
* '''highly reconfigurable and controllable''': researchers can experiment with a fully customized software stack thanks to bare-metal deployment features, and can isolate their experiment at the networking layer  | |||
* '''advanced monitoring and measurement features for traces collection of networking and power consumption''', providing a deep understanding of experiments  | |||
* '''designed to support Open Science and reproducible research''', with full traceability of infrastructure and software changes on the testbed  | |||
* '''a vibrant community''' of 500+ users supported by a solid technical team  | |||

Grid'5000 is supported by a scientific interest group (GIS) hosted by Inria and including CNRS, RENATER and several Universities as well as other organizations. Inria has been supporting Grid'5000 through ADT ALADDIN-G5K (2007-2013), ADT LAPLACE (2014-2016), and IPL [[Hemera|HEMERA]] (2010-2014).  | |||
